Job Description
The Graphic Designer supports a variety of design projects across all ministries to help lead people to be growing followers of Jesus who love God and love people. This person reports to the Digital and Communications Director.
Schedule
This is a part-time, exempt position requiring 28 hours per week. The schedule includes designated office hours during the week, and occasional flexibility for events outside of regular hours.
Experience & Abilities
- Education: Degree or equivalent work experience in graphic design is preferred.
- Experience: A proven proficiency in design including brand management.
- License/Certification: A valid PA drivers license.
- Specific Abilities: Proficient with MacOS and Adobe Creative Suite. Familiar with Microsoft apps. Detail-oriented, values quality, able to multitask and perform assigned tasks with limited supervision. Skilled at designing marketing materials and resources. Excellent people skills and professional presentation in a collaborative working environment.
Bonus: Photography skills, social media strategy, UX/UI design knowledge, printing knowledge, experience in Basecamp or other project management software.
What This Person Does
- Design for WC main brand and across all ministries including materials for print, web, social media, LED screens, email, merchandise, posters, booklets, etc.
- Help to manage, implement, and innovate using Worship Centers brand guide including development and maintenance of sub-brands for WC ministries.
- Collaborate and design for building environment updates.
- Assist the Digital and Communications team with social media tasks including brainstorming and scheduling posts.
- Serve WC ministries by providing graphic design needs as assigned through project pitch requests.
- Be the point person for in-house printing projects booklets, cards, etc.
- Order promotional materials, print projects, and merchandise as needed.
- Other duties as assigned.
